Abstract
Anorexia nervosa (AN) is a severe mental disorder accompanied by extensive metabolic and endocrine abnormalities. It has been associated with hypercortisolism using short-term measurement methods such as 24 h-urine, saliva, and blood. The aim of this study was to examine whether the proposed hypercortisolism in acutely underweight AN (acAN) is also reflected in a long-term measure: hair cortisol (HCC). To gain further insight, we compared hair cortisol to a well-established classical cortisol measure (24 h-urine; UCC) longitudinally in acAN. Hair samples were collected and analyzed using a LC-MS/MS-based method to provide a monthly cortisol value. We compared HCC in samples of 40 acAN with 40 pairwise age-matched healthy controls (HC) as well as 23 long-term recovered AN participants (recAN) with 23 pairwise age-matched HC (cross-sectional design). In the second part, UCC collected weekly during 14 weeks of weight-restoration therapy in 16 acAN was compared with the (time-corresponding) HCC using linear mixed models and bivariate correlations (longitudinal design). No group differences in HCC occurred comparing acAN and recAN to HC (cross-sectional study). The longitudinal analysis revealed a decrease of UCC but not HCC with weight gain. Furthermore, there was no overall significant association between UCC and HCC. Only in the last four weeks of weight-restoration therapy we found a significant moderate correlation between UCC and HCC. HCC did not reflect the expected hypercortisolism in acAN and did not decrease during short-term weight-restoration. Time-corresponding measurements of UCC and HCC were not consistently associated in our longitudinal analysis of acAN undergoing inpatient treatment. Given the drastic metabolic disturbances in acutely underweight AN our findings could be interpreted as disturbed cortisol incorporation or altered activity of 11-β-HSD-enzymes in the hair follicle.
